From now on, you can log in by scanning a QR code that smoothly continues the process on your smartphone.
The new QR login method is designed for moments when a device cannot open a new browser session. Think of an embedded browser in a car or an embedded environment within a CRM or telephony platform. In such situations, resuming the login procedure on your smartphone becomes a powerful advantage. By scanning the QR code, you prevent the login from getting stuck and maintain a smooth experience from start to finish.
Avoiding text input increases both speed and convenience. This is especially beneficial on devices with limited input capabilities. Instead of struggling with tiny keyboards on touchscreens or small displays, the smartphone becomes the central tool to complete the login effortlessly.
Authentication takes place on a trusted device that is already secured, such as a smartphone with biometrics. This provides users with more confidence while keeping technical security layers fully intact. You simply complete the process in an environment you use daily and are already familiar with.
Many embedded browsers block pop ups or do not support opening new tabs. The QR flow bypasses this issue entirely, making it possible to log in even when a device’s technical limitations would otherwise disrupt the normal process.
This new login method is now available across all our Bubble365 apps, with the exception of the Bubble365 Mobile App itself, where the added value would be minimal.
